The image depicts an indoor scene in Domjur, India, likely a workshop or sales area for intricate jewelry. In the foreground, a man with a mustache, wearing a white shirt and a grey zip-up jacket, is visible from the chest up. His arms are raised, and he is seen handling or inspecting small, gold-colored jewelry items, some of which are contained within clear plastic pouches. He wears a ring with a prominent green stone on his right hand. His hands are interacting with the hands of another person, partially visible in the midground, suggesting an exchange, presentation, or joint examination of the items. Spread across a white surface, presumably a table or workbench, is a diverse collection of ornate, gold-toned imitation jewelry. These pieces include elaborate necklaces and other adornments, featuring various colored stones such as mint green, soft pink, and ruby red, alongside clear or white facets. The designs are intricate, showcasing traditional South Asian aesthetics. Some items are still in individual clear plastic bags, while others are laid out directly on the surface. In the background, shelving units are visible, holding what appears to be various supplies, materials, or packaged goods, suggesting a manufacturing or trading environment. An industrial fan is also present on the left side of the frame, indicating the practical nature of the workspace. The scene conveys an atmosphere of focused activity centered around the display and handling of these decorative accessories. No visible text is present in the image.
